A medical alert system in Danville can supply many elderly and disabled individuals with the ability to survive on their own, and exercise a high degree of independence. Here’s what you have to understand before signing up with a medical alert system company.
Technically, an alert system is normally comprised of a wrist band transmitter– resembling a wrist watch– or a necklace-type transmitter that is worn at all times. If the person must have a medical problem or mishap, they can just press a button on the used transmitter to communicate with the medical alert tracking.
This helps the tracking center professional to much better encourage you in case of a medical emergency, and they may likewise send emergency medical help if needed. Optionally, the tracking center can be advised to likewise call one or more of your family members whenever the help button is pressed.The cost of a medical alert system can differ inning accordance with the level of service you require, however in general they are an extremely reasonably-priced option to helped living centers.

Emergency Buttons and Medical Alert button in 94506
Panic Buttons for the senior are readily available in numerous options and with many functions. Generally a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or heart attack. These panic buttons can be worn around the neck or as a bracelet.
The person in distress presses a button, which sends out a signal. Typically this will place an emergency call to the numbers currently programmed into the system.
When an individual takes the call, he is asked to go into in a number. If the number is gone into properly, then the system assumes that it is a live person and not an answering machine. The system will play the message for the individual lifting the call.
In a 2-way system, a 2-way interaction is established in between the individual in distress and the emergency alert company. This is why it is crucial you choose a trustworthy company. It is well worth the few additional dollars spent each month, in return for quality service and reaction.
Some 2-way company will supply extra service. Some alarm business will pull up medical records of the client to determine if he has any recognized medical problems. This guarantees instant service and can avoid a lot of hassle and aggravation.
Panic buttons for the elderly can be worn as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are generally water proof so there is no concerns with the emergency alert systems getting spoiled due to moisture.

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
-
-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?
Originally, medical alert systems were created to work inside your house, with your landline telephone.
And you can still go that route. Lots of companies likewise now provide the option of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who may not have a landline.
With these systems, pushing the wearable call button allows you to speak with a dispatcher through a base unit situated in your home.
Many business provide mobile options, too. You can use these systems in your home, however they’ll likewise allow you to call for help while you’re out and about.
These run over cellular networks and integrate GPS technology. In this manner, if you get lost or push the call button for help but are not able to talk, the monitoring service can find you.

-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?
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.

- Whats the Cost?
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

The Town of Danville[10] is located in the San Ramon Valley in Contra Costa County, California. It is one of the incorporated municipalities in California that uses "town" in its name instead of "city". The population was 42,039 in 2010.
Danville hosts a farmer's market each Saturday next to the San Ramon Valley Museum.[11]
The Iron Horse Regional Trail runs through Danville. It was first a railroad that has been converted to an 80-foot (24 m) wide corridor of bike and hike trails as well as controlled intersections. Extending from Pleasanton to Concord, the trail passes through Danville.[12]
